
Our Philosophy of Care
Strathmore Lodge aims to provide its residents with a secure, relaxed, friendly and homely environment in which their care, well-being and comfort is of prime importance.
Our Carers will strive to preserve and maintain the dignity, individuality and privacy of all residents within a warm, friendly and caring atmosphere, and in doing so will be sensitive to the residents ever changing needs.
Such needs may be medical/therapeutic (for physical and mental welfare), cultural, psychological, spiritual, emotional and social and residents are encouraged to participate in the development of their individualised Plan of Care, as are family and friends where appropriate.
This will be achieved through programmes of activities designed to encourage mental alertness, self esteem, and social interaction with other residents and with recognition of the core values of care which are fundamental to the philosophy of our home.
